Abstract

A system and method for identifying media segments using audio augmented image cross-comparison is disclosed, in which a media segment identifying system analyses both audio and video content, producing a unique identifier to compare with previously identified media segments in a media segment database. The characteristic landmark-linked-image-comparisons are constructed by first identifying an audio landmark. The audio landmark is an audio peak that exceeds a predetermined threshold. Two digital images are then obtained, one associated directly with the audio landmark, and one obtained a predetermined landmark time removed from the first image. The two images are then used to provide a characteristic landmark-linked-image-comparison. The pair of images are reduced in pixel size and converted to gray scale. Corresponding pixels are compared to form a numeric comparison. One image is mirrored before comparison to reduce the possibility of null comparisons.
